The measurement of the room is the initial step to determine the size of the sectional. You'll need to ensure that the sectional will fit in the space and be able to easily fit through your doorway. Use masking tape to trace the outline of the sectional on the floor. This will help you determine its size and depth.

The length of your sectional is crucial. To figure out the length you need to measure from the back of the couch to the front edge of the chaise or the seat with the longest length. This is an important aspect, as the length of a sectional sofa can determine the level of comfort it offers.

A sectional sofa can be an investment worth making in your living room due to a variety of reasons. They are great for large, open layouts because they provide an unlimited amount of flexibility. You can alter the seating arrangement to entertain or to change the mood of your living space. They can also be used to divide an open floor plan, and to maximize the space you have.

In addition to offering an infinite number of configurations, a sectional couch is also available in a variety of styles. For example, a curved sectional sofa can add a unique aesthetic to your living room. This is because it isn't flush with the wall, which means that it can accommodate more people than a straight sofa. This kind of sofa could be more difficult to move and is more expensive than a standard sofa.

The L-shaped sectional is a different option. It can be used in almost any setting. They can provide plenty of seating for family members and guests as well as allowing you to maximize space in your living space. If you're seeking more seating options you should think about getting a U-shaped sectional, that can be set up in three different configurations based on your requirements and preferences.
